Episode 40: Beyond Menopause Symptoms - The Autoimmune Connection You Need to Know

from Beyond Hormone Symptoms Podcast · host Gloria Halim

In this episode of Beyond Hormone Symptoms, I sit down with health practitioner Valerie Engelson to explore the complex relationship between autoimmune conditions and hormonalhealth in midlife women. Building on our Episode 11 discussion about the interplay of hormones, genetics, and environmental factors, we dive deeper into what it really means to live well with conditions like Hashimoto's thyroiditis and lupus.  If you've been told yoursymptoms are "just menopause" but suspect something more is going on, this conversation is for you.
